Mission Statement

PACE programs keep older adults as healthy as possible in the community by providing comprehensive health care and social services including: primary and specialty medical care, a day health program, social work services, rehabilitation, housing (if necessary) and much more.

Description

Providence ElderPlace is an innovative program of health care and social services for older adults. Our model of care is known as PACE (Program of All Inclusive Care for the Elderly).Participants attend the Providence ElderPlace Center on a regular basis, and transportation is provided. The ElderPlace team of health care and social service professionals and our affiliates provide comprehensive integrated care to our participants.
